Q&A
What is required before you break ground in my yard?
The North Carolina 811 utility locate ticket is legally mandatory and your first step. Hitting a buried line in Wendell Falls, such as fiber optic or gas, creates major repair liabilities and fines. Our crew files all necessary permits with the Wendell Planning Department and will not schedule installation until 811 clearance is confirmed and marked.

What fencing material holds up best in Wendell?
Material selection must combat Very Heavy termite risk and Moderate soil corrosivity. Pressure-treated pine requires ground-contact rating and regular termite inspections. For metal, use aluminum or galvanized steel with stainless steel fasteners. Standard zinc-coated screws will rust, causing unsightly streaks on the finish within 18 months.
What are the height and placement rules for my Wendell property?
Wendell zoning limits fences to 4 feet in front yards and 6 feet in rear and side yards. A 0-foot setback allows building directly on your property line. Critical rule: For corner lots, especially near US-64, a clear 'sight triangle' must be maintained. No visual obstruction is permitted within 25 feet of the intersection's curb lines.
Will my fence posts be stable in the Wendell Falls soil?
Footings must extend below the 8-inch frost line to prevent frost heave. The 2021 IRC requires posts in frost-prone soils, like those in our climate, to be set a minimum of 12 inches deeper than the line. A post set in just 6 inches of concrete will tilt and fail within two seasons due to ground movement.

How do you build a fence to handle our high winds?
Design is based on the 115 MPH V-ult wind speed rating. This ultimate design wind speed dictates post spacing, concrete footing diameter, and bracket strength. A standard 6-foot panel requires 4x4 posts set in 12-inch diameter concrete footings at 8-foot centers or less to survive peak storm season gusts without racking or failure.
